TitleSale book containing: 1. Estate at King's Walden, Herts. for Mr Gootheridge, being Preston Hill Farm, 240 acres (£11,400) 2 June 1848 2. 7a cinquefoil, 7a 1r clover, 17a grass at Royston for S.G. Fordham, esq. (£44 5s 6d) 5 June 1848 3. Furniture for Mr Wm. Wright, Whittlesford (£30 13s 6d) 22 June 1848 4. Oak trees at Little Chishill for Sir P. Soame, bt (£41 15s) 23 June 1848 5. Furniture, farm stock etc. at Meldreth for Mr W.C. Scruby (£239 4s 2d) 27 June 1848 6. Estates at Ashwell for R. Clutterbuck, esq. house, 76a 2r 37p with plans (£2897) 29 June 1848 7. Estate at Ashwell, and 40a 3r 2p and house, 6a at Guilden Morden for Executors of Mr Saml. Bowman (£1625) 30 June 1848 8. Estates (house, garden and 3 tenements) at Barley for Executor of Mr John Searle £384 4s) 30 June 1848 9. Estates (3 tenements and 4a 3r 14p) of Mr John Whitlock, Sharpenhoe End, Barley (£420) (S.P. Loose) 30 June 1848 10. 2 double tenements at Therfield for Messrs Hawkes (£84) 3 July 1848 11. Furniture etc. at Melbourn for Mr Simon Mortlock (£59 1s) 4 July 1848 12. 15 acres grass and afterfeed at Bassingbourn for Mr S. Sell (£32) 7 July 1848 13. Clover and grass for Capt. W.H. Young, 7a. 2r., near Buckland (£22) 10 July 1848 14. Furniture of Mrs Evans (dec.) at Buckland (£43 12s 6d) 17 July 1848 15. Furniture of Mr Balley, Bassingbourn (£69 0s 4d) 18 July 1848 16. Growing crops at Caxton for Executors of Mr Brook (£56 16s 11d) 31 July 1848
Date1848
CreatorNameRowley, Son and Royce, estate agents and auctioneers of Royston
